The procedure 1- Under the lower lip inside the mouth In order to reshape or reduce the bone, creating a harmonic appearance, the surgeon works in the area with appropriate electrical instruments, carefully chosen. The incision is sutured and stitched, and then a tape is applied in the chin area. Anesthesia: The procedure may be performed under local anesthesia (sedated, numbed, and awake). Only in some cases, General anesthesia is required. Length: Between 30 minutes and one hour. Hospitalization: Patients usually return home within hours of the procedure. Some patients require an overnight stay. After the surgery It is recommendable to follow post-operative instruction list to help reduce the risk of complications. There may be some pain, which can be managed with oral medications. The surgeon may have recommendations to reduce swelling, such as elevating your head.
